The timing of the disruption is not clearly specified in the available input, but the latest Drewry weekly update dated July 10, 2026 points to a sharp escalation in refrigerated container costs on the Asia-Europe trade. A steep rise in spot rates, combined with low reefer equipment availability at key European ports, is drawing attention from exporters of seafood, fruit, vegetables, and dairy products, as well as logistics providers and buyers managing time-sensitive deliveries. For the industry, the issue is not only higher freight pricing, but also longer delivery cycles for temperature-sensitive cargo.
According to the provided Drewry weekly report reference dated 2026-07-10, the spot rate for a 40-foot refrigerated container on the Asia-Europe route reached $8,250, up 37% week on week. The reported drivers were rerouting linked to the Red Sea situation and a widening shortage of refrigerated plug capacity at European ports.
The same input states that reefer container availability at Rotterdam, Hamburg, and Piraeus was below 42%. As a result, export delivery cycles for temperature-sensitive agricultural products, including seafood, fruit and vegetables, and dairy, were extended by 5 to 8 days.
From an industry perspective, exporters handling seafood, produce, and dairy are likely to feel the impact most directly because their cargo depends on both temperature control and schedule reliability. The main pressure points are freight budgeting, shipment planning, and the risk of delivery commitments becoming harder to meet when transit or port handling stretches by several additional days.
For importers, wholesalers, and downstream distribution businesses, the reported 5 to 8 day extension matters because it affects replenishment timing for products with limited shelf-life tolerance. What deserves closer attention is whether delivery planning, receiving schedules, and inventory turnover assumptions still match current shipping conditions on the Asia-Europe lane.
Logistics providers, freight forwarders, and other cold chain service operators may face pressure in equipment allocation, slot coordination, and exception handling. Analysis shows that low reefer availability at major European ports can turn a freight cost issue into a capacity management issue, especially for cargo that cannot easily shift to a less controlled transport setup.
